In others, autism indications might not show up until 24 months old or later. Neurodivergent Importantly, some youngsters with ASD acquire brand-new abilities and meet developmental landmarks till around 18 to 24 months old, and afterwards they quit getting brand-new skills or shed the skills they as soon as had. There's no chance to avoid autism range problem, however there are therapy alternatives. Early medical diagnosis and intervention is most useful and can enhance actions, abilities and language development.

Autistic people with stereotyped discussions may also deal with misdiagnoses. Common misdiagnoses may include conceited individuality condition, schizoid personality problem, schizotypal character problem, and in many cases, even antisocial personality disorder.
